Is the Bills Game Over? Strengths That Offer Hope
Despite the recent struggles, it's crucial to remember the Bills' inherent strengths. Josh Allen, when playing at his best, is one of the most electrifying quarterbacks in the NFL. His ability to make plays with his arm and legs can single-handedly change the outcome of a game. The receiving corps, led by Stefon Diggs, is still a force to be reckoned with. Furthermore, the Bills have a proven track record of resilience under coach Sean McDermott. They've overcome adversity before, and that experience could prove invaluable. Is the Bills Game Over? Weaknesses Exposing Cracks
However, the Bills' weaknesses are equally apparent. The offensive line has struggled to provide consistent protection for Allen, leading to hurried throws and sacks. The running game has been inconsistent, making the offense predictable at times. On defense, injuries have depleted the linebacker corps, leaving them susceptible to opposing rushing attacks. Is the Bills Game Over? The Path to Redemption: What Needs to Happen
To reignite their Super Bowl aspirations, the Bills need to address several key areas:
- Health: Getting key players back from injury is crucial. This will bolster both the offensive and defensive units.
- Consistency: The offense needs to find a rhythm and avoid costly turnovers. Allen must make smart decisions and rely on his supporting cast.
- Run Game: Establishing a consistent running game will take pressure off Allen and make the offense more balanced.
- Defensive Adjustments: The defense needs to tighten up against the run and generate more pressure on opposing quarterbacks.
- Discipline: Reducing penalties and mental mistakes will be essential to avoid self-inflicted wounds.
- Momentum: Stringing together a few convincing wins could restore confidence and momentum heading into the playoffs.
